How to Find Products for Squidoo Christmas Cash

In the Squidoo Christmas Cash Blueprint I suggested you use Amazon as your product provider. That’s all fine and good but dang, Amazon is a BIG place! How do you find products that are just what we’re looking for in this situation?

Here’s some suggestions:

1. Don’t complicate things, and stop thinking about it so hard. Just go to Amazon and pick a category from one of the options under “shop all categories“.

2. Pick a subcategory once you pick something. Don’t think about it, just click. The more you overanalyze this the longer it will take, and the more you will psych yourself out. There are great products in any/every category.

Here’s an example  I went to clothing/shoes/jewelry. I picked jewelry when given the options. Once I picked jewelry I’m given TONS of options as well. However, what I like to do is scroll down and choose to shop by price. :)

Now depending on how comfortable you feel you can choose products priced as high as over $10k in the jewelry department.

You’ll find the shop by price option in every department, you may have to get one more level specific in some categories. Like if you pick exercise and fitness you’ll have to pick one more option before you get the shop by price option, so choose bikes, or treadmills, or whatever, then look on the left hand side about half way down the page and you’ll see the shop by price option. :)

That’s a pretty handy trick.

3. Depending on the department you can shop by seller or designer. There are going to be well known designers that are going to be high priced items ~ now some of them may be pretty competitive, but it’s worth looking at.

4. Shop by reviews. Amazon reviews are a very handy thing for internet marketers (you). They give you great ideas for content, they give you reviews, and they give you social proof, which is very important. You want to make sure whatever product you choose, no matter how expensive or inexpensive has at least a few GOOD reviews. When I say good I mean at least 4 star rating. The more reviews the BETTER!! This gives you a great chance to use all that great information provided from actual product users. You can even choose to search by stars given if you want. :)

That’s how I filter and find my products for Squidoo Christmas Cash lenses.

Let’s recap:

1. Don’t complicate things, just pick a category.

2. Shop by price (left hand sidebar)

3. Choose products with plenty of good reviews (either sidebar or under the products)

Those three things should help you quickly and easily narrow down your choices to start checking for the search volume and competition. Once you’ve found something that fits ~ go with it!! Don’t worry about it, don’t over think it, just grab it and take action. :)

    • Jackie says:

      IF the total PR of the top ten sites is 15 how can the average be 3? If you divide 15 by 10 it does NOT equal 3. I suck at math but of this I’m pretty sure.

      The point of having the reviews is for social proof. You can show others what other people who own the product are saying about it ~ and that they like the product. It helps you not have to create as much content and helps you not have to sell the product ~ the reviews from other people do that for you.

      If YOU have the jewelry and can talk about it from that perspective that would be fine. If you can find other reviews online about the jewelry you might be able to pull those in as well.

      The numbers look good otherwise so if you want to try it go ahead ~ it will just be a little more difficult to come up with content and provide social proof.
